Clementine’s are in season and too good to pass up! The sweetness of the fruit is balanced by the acidity of the dressing. It’s addictive!
Here’s what you’ll need:
Heart of Romaine lettuce
Toasted almonds
3 clementines
croutons
3 green onions chopped
Dressing:
2 tablespoons apricot preserves
1 tablespoon white balsamic vinegar
1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ar
pinch of kosher salt and ground pepper
1 tablespoon grapeseed oil
To a small mixing bowl add 2 tablespoons of apricot preserves.
Next add the apple cider vinegar, balsamic vinegar, oil, and salt and pepper.
In a large salad bowl add the chopped lettuce, chopped green onions, toasted almonds, peeled and segmented clementines and a few croutons.
Mix the dressing until the ingredients are well incorporated.
Pour on the dressing and toss the salad.
